With the rising demand for mental health services, Virtual Intensive Outpatient Programs (IOP) have emerged as a crucial resource. These programs provide essential therapy options that allow individuals to seek help without leaving the comfort of their homes, a significant advantage for those balancing work and family commitments.
Residents of Floyd have a unique opportunity to engage with tailored therapeutic services designed to meet their specific needs. Virtual IOP offers structured hours of therapy, ranging from 9 to 20 hours per week, ensuring that everything from depression to substance use disorders can be addressed effectively. The flexibility to participate in sessions online means individuals can maintain their daily obligations while receiving the support they deserve.
